summaryrefslogtreecommitdiff
path: root/sysutils/dmg2img/patches/patch-aa
blob: 96d7b5e7cb590ac98c31df7b83100c1132e7ae10 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
$NetBSD: patch-aa,v 1.1.1.1 2009/10/29 04:24:27 agc Exp $

--- Makefile	2009/10/29 04:05:47	1.1
+++ Makefile	2009/10/29 04:06:22
@@ -1,12 +1,12 @@
 #CC = gcc
 ##CFLAGS = -O3
 CFLAGS = -O2 -Wall
-BIN_DIR = ${DESTDIR}/usr/bin
+BIN_DIR = ${DESTDIR}${PREFIX}/bin
 
 all: dmg2img vfdecrypt 
 
 dmg2img: dmg2img.c dmg2img.h mntcmd.h gpt.h dmg2img.o base64.o adc.o 
-	$(CC) -s -o dmg2img dmg2img.o base64.o adc.o -L. -lz -lbz2
+	$(CC) -o dmg2img dmg2img.o base64.o adc.o -L. -lz -lbz2
 
 dmg2img.o: dmg2img.c dmg2img.h
 	$(CC) $(CFLAGS) -c dmg2img.c
@@ -18,11 +18,12 @@
 	$(CC) $(CFLAGS) -c adc.c
 
 vfdecrypt: vfdecrypt.c
-	$(CC) $(CFLAGS) -s -o vfdecrypt vfdecrypt.c -lcrypto
+	$(CC) $(CFLAGS) -o vfdecrypt vfdecrypt.c -lcrypto
 
 install: dmg2img vfdecrypt
 	mkdir -p ${BIN_DIR}
-	install -c -s -m 755 -o root -g root dmg2img vfdecrypt $(BIN_DIR)
+	${BSD_INSTALL_PROGRAM} -c dmg2img $(BIN_DIR)
+	${BSD_INSTALL_PROGRAM} -c vfdecrypt $(BIN_DIR)
 
 clean:
 	rm -f dmg2img vfdecrypt *~ *.o core